package com.google.zxing.client.android.result;
import android.content.ActivityNotFoundException;
import android.util.Log;
import com.google.zxing.client.android.R;
import com.google.zxing.client.result.CalendarParsedResult;
import com.google.zxing.client.result.ParsedResult;
import android.app.Activity;
import android.content.Intent;
import java.text.DateFormat;
import java.util.Date;
/**
* Handles calendar entries encoded in QR Codes.
*
* @author dswitkin@google.com (Daniel Switkin)
* @author Sean Owen
*/
public final class CalendarResultHandler extends ResultHandler {
private static final String TAG = CalendarResultHandler.class.getSimpleName();
private static int[] buttons;
public CalendarResultHandler(Activity activity, ParsedResult result) {
super(activity, result);
buttons = new int[]{
fakeR.getId("string", "button_add_calendar")
};
}
@Override
public int getButtonCount() {
return buttons.length;
}
@Override
public int getButtonText(int index) {
return buttons[index];
}
@Override
public void handleButtonPress(int index) {
if (index == 0) {
CalendarParsedResult calendarResult = (CalendarParsedResult) getResult();
String description = calendarResult.getDescription();
String organizer = calendarResult.getOrganizer();
if (organizer != null) { // No separate Intent key, put in description
if (description == null) {
description = organizer;
} else {
description = description + '\n' + organizer;
}
}
addCalendarEvent(calendarResult.getSummary(),
calendarResult.getStart(),
calendarResult.isStartAllDay(),
calendarResult.getEnd(),
calendarResult.getLocation(),
description,
calendarResult.getAttendees());
}
}
/**
* Sends an intent to create a new calendar event by prepopulating the Add Event UI. Older
* versions of the system have a bug where the event title will not be filled out.
*
* @param summary A description of the event
* @param start The start time
* @param allDay if true, event is considered to be all day starting from start time
* @param end The end time (optional)
* @param location a text description of the event location
* @param description a text description of the event itself
* @param attendees attendees to invite
*/
private void addCalendarEvent(String summary,
Date start,
boolean allDay,
Date end,
String location,
String description,
String[] attendees) {
Intent intent = new Intent(Intent.ACTION_INSERT);
intent.setType("vnd.android.cursor.item/event");
long startMilliseconds = start.getTime();
intent.putExtra("beginTime", startMilliseconds);
if (allDay) {
intent.putExtra("allDay", true);
}
long endMilliseconds;
if (end == null) {
if (allDay) {
// + 1 day
endMilliseconds = startMilliseconds + 24 * 60 * 60 * 1000;
} else {
endMilliseconds = startMilliseconds;
}
} else {
endMilliseconds = end.getTime();
}
intent.putExtra("endTime", endMilliseconds);
intent.putExtra("title", summary);
intent.putExtra("eventLocation", location);
intent.putExtra("description", description);
if (attendees != null) {
intent.putExtra(Intent.EXTRA_EMAIL, attendees);
// Documentation says this is either a String[] or comma-separated String, which is right?
}
try {
// Do this manually at first
rawLaunchIntent(intent);
} catch (ActivityNotFoundException anfe) {
Log.w(TAG, "No calendar app available that responds to " + Intent.ACTION_INSERT);
// For calendar apps that don't like "INSERT":
intent.setAction(Intent.ACTION_EDIT);
launchIntent(intent); // Fail here for real if nothing can handle it
}
}
@Override
public CharSequence getDisplayContents() {
CalendarParsedResult calResult = (CalendarParsedResult) getResult();
StringBuilder result = new StringBuilder(100);
ParsedResult.maybeAppend(calResult.getSummary(), result);
Date start = calResult.getStart();
ParsedResult.maybeAppend(format(calResult.isStartAllDay(), start), result);
Date end = calResult.getEnd();
if (end != null) {
if (calResult.isEndAllDay() && !start.equals(end)) {
// Show only year/month/day
// if it's all-day and this is the end date, it's exclusive, so show the user
// that it ends on the day before to make more intuitive sense.
// But don't do it if the event already (incorrectly?) specifies the same start/end
end = new Date(end.getTime() - 24 * 60 * 60 * 1000);
}
ParsedResult.maybeAppend(format(calResult.isEndAllDay(), end), result);
}
ParsedResult.maybeAppend(calResult.getLocation(), result);
ParsedResult.maybeAppend(calResult.getOrganizer(), result);
ParsedResult.maybeAppend(calResult.getAttendees(), result);
ParsedResult.maybeAppend(calResult.getDescription(), result);
return result.toString();
}
private static String format(boolean allDay, Date date) {
if (date == null) {
return null;
}
DateFormat format = allDay
? DateFormat.getDateInstance(DateFormat.MEDIUM)
: DateFormat.getDateTimeInstance(DateFormat.MEDIUM, DateFormat.MEDIUM);
return format.format(date);
}
@Override
public int getDisplayTitle() {
return fakeR.getId("string", "result_calendar");
}
}
